Gutter Blockage Removal in Bergen County, NJ
Gutter blockage removal services focus on clearing debris such as leaves, twigs, dirt, and other obstructions that can accumulate in gutters over time. These services are essential for maintaining proper water flow and preventing issues like overflowing gutters, water damage to the roof or foundation, and pest infestations. Projects typically involve inspecting the gutter system, removing debris manually or with specialized tools, and flushing the gutters to ensure they are clear and functioning correctly. Homeowners often request this service before or during seasons with heavy leaf fall or after storms to safeguard their property from water-related problems.

Gutter Blockage Removal Questions
What causes gutter blockages? Common causes include leaves, twigs, and debris accumulating in the gutters, as well as buildup from dirt and algae over time.
How can I tell if my gutters are blocked? Signs include water overflowing during rain, sagging gutters, and the presence of debris or standing water in the gutter system.
What are the benefits of removing gutter blockages? Clearing blockages helps prevent water damage to the roof, foundation, and landscaping, and reduces the risk of pest infestations.
What projects typically involve gutter blockage removal? Services are often requested for routine maintenance, preparation for seasonal storms, or after severe weather events to ensure proper drainage.
